What is JIE
• JIE is a secure environment, comprised of shared information
technology (IT) infrastructure, enterprise services, and a single
security architecture to achieve full spectrum superiority,
improve mission effectiveness, increase security and realize IT
efficiencies. JIE is operated and managed per Unified
Command Plan (UCP) using enforceable standards,
specifications, and common tactics, techniques, and
procedures (TTPs).

JIE Transition
In today’s environment, the
Combatant Commands
(COCOMs) are provided with
Service-centric IT networks and
IT services focused on Service–
unique domains. This Servicecentric approach extends
beyond networks to identity
and access management
processes, data centers,
mission and business
applications, commercial offthe-shelf (COTS) hardware and
software, and IT procurement
practices.
